2026 marks UCL’s Bicentenary and 200 years since we were founded as London’s first ever university. To celebrate, we have relased new wallpapers you can download to your devices.
The three images selected show some of the history of UCL as well as bringing the imagery up to date with a shot from one of our most recent buildings. They are formated for use on a standard UCL desktop.
We’ve already rolled out one of the UCL 200 images to Desktop@UCL Anywhere and teaching space machines but wanted to give all staff the opportunity to use the UCL200 images on your machines.
- An early illustration is of "University College London with the intended wings" which as we know didn’t quite materialise as shown.
2. This Edwardian photograph from 1909 shows a scene of a bazaar and fete taking place in the Quad.
